ykous 2022-02-19 17:47 采纳率: 100%
浏览 25
已结题

数据一致性为什么可以被放弃

过去,我总是认为系统的数据一致性非常重要,然后我发现如果要能够绝对保障数据的一致性,在仅有数据库的单库系统中,几乎所有的写入操作都要使用串行化事务才能做到,而我听说过这种隔离级别是很少用的,这是我第一次意识到一致性的必要性要求可能不是绝对的,再到后来,缓存,多库等分布式特性后我发现想要一直保障一致性是几乎不可能的事。但是,缺乏一致性的系统总是让我感到不安,我不理解为什么可以容许不一致的系统

  • 写回答

1条回答 默认 最新

  • 辽宁吴奇隆 2022-02-19 18:25
    关注

    为了性能考虑,强一致性不重要,但都会最终一致性。

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 系统已结题 3月8日
  • 已采纳回答 2月28日
  • 创建了问题 2月19日

悬赏问题

  • ¥15 求jacquard数据集
  • ¥15 w10部分软件不能联网
  • ¥15 关于安装hbase的问题(操作系统-windows)
  • ¥15 cadence617版本,如何做一个参数可调的反相器
  • ¥15 novnc连接pve虚拟机报错安全协议不支持262
  • ¥15 设备精度0.03给多少公差能达到CPK1.33
  • ¥15 qt+ffmpeg报错non-existing PPS 0 referenced
  • ¥15 FOC simulink
  • ¥50 MacOS 使用虚拟机安装k8s
  • ¥20 玩游戏gpu和cpu利用率特别低,玩游戏卡顿